Problem Statement

Globine Energy addresses the urgent need for scalable, efficient, and environmentally friendly renewable energy solutions in the context of a global move away from fossil-based energy. Horizontal axis wind turbines, which currently dominate the renewable energy market, encounter limitations in terms of costs, scalability, efficiency, location, environmental & visual impact. The world thus far has failed to fully benefit from the enormous potential offered by the abundant natural resource of wind. With ambitious global targets for renewable energy such as the EU's goal of reaching 42% by 2030, there is an imperative for a significant shift in approach. Globine Energy's patented vertical axis wind turbine offers an approach that enables accelerated and widespread adoption of wind energy and drives the crucial transition towards a sustainable future, helping accelerate a reduction in dependence on fossil fuels.

Which do you think are the innovative factors of your idea?

The main innovative factors of the Globine Energy Vertical Axis Wind Turbine (VAWT) include scalability and versatility, enhanced wind capture with dynamic gate technology, low wind speed start-up capability, zero-waste manufacturing, a modular build approach, and ground-level installation. These factors enable the VAWT to adapt to various energy needs, maximize energy extraction from the wind, operate efficiently in low wind speeds, reduce waste in manufacturing, simplify construction and installation and provide flexibility in site selection, making it a highly innovative and promising solution for renewable energy generation. Overall, Globine Energy's approach enables greater numbers of urban-based turbine installations and reduces the emphasis on offshore installations.

To which challenges does your idea provide a solution to?

Globine Energy provides solutions to the following top challenges:
- Limited scalability and efficiency of current renewable energy installations.
- Environmental impact of wind turbine installations.
- High costs associated with the development, installation, and maintenance of wind turbines.
- Limited availability of suitable land for large-scale onshore wind projects.
- Distance of offshore wind installations from urban areas, requiring extensive transmission infrastructure.
- Concerns over the visual impact of wind turbines in scenic and populated areas.
- Limited operational lifespan and reliability of existing wind turbine technologies.
- Dependence on specific wind conditions for effective power generation e.g. shut down during stormy weather.
